Marks & Spencer Office Manager Salaries in New York

The average Marks & Spencer Office Manager in New York earns an estimated $74,029 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$63,029 with a $11,000 bonus. Marks & Spencer's Office Manager compensation is $16,110 more than theaverage for a Office Manager. Office Manager salaries at Marks & Spencer in New York can range from $60,000 - $84,050.

In New York, The Operations Department at Marks & Spencer earns $10,129 more on average than the Business Development Department.

Office Manager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Office Manager at companies similar size to Marks & Spencer reported making $57,905, while the average male Office Manager at similar sized companies reported making $65,316.

Office Manager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Office Manager at companies similar size to Marks & Spencer reported making $78,540, while the average Caucasian Office Manager at similar sized companies reported making $57,404.
